软件文档管理化的内容组织与维护

张开发
2026/4/20 18:52:19 15 分钟阅读

分享文章

软件文档管理化的内容组织与维护
软件文档管理化的内容组织与维护在软件开发过程中文档是项目成功的关键要素之一。无论是需求分析、设计说明、用户手册还是测试报告高质量的文档能够帮助团队高效协作、降低沟通成本并为后续维护提供可靠依据。随着项目规模扩大和版本迭代频繁文档的碎片化、冗余和版本混乱问题日益突出。如何实现软件文档的管理化确保内容组织清晰、维护高效成为开发团队亟需解决的挑战。**文档分类与标准化**文档管理的第一步是明确分类与标准化。根据项目需求可以将文档划分为技术文档如设计说明书、API文档、管理文档如项目计划、会议记录和用户文档如操作手册、帮助文档。每类文档应制定统一的模板包括格式、标题层级和术语规范确保团队成员能够快速理解与编写。标准化不仅能提升文档质量还能减少后期维护的复杂度。**版本控制与历史追溯**文档的版本管理是避免混乱的核心。借助版本控制工具如Git、SVN团队可以记录每次修改的内容、时间和责任人确保文档与代码同步更新。通过分支管理可以区分不同版本的文档例如开发版、测试版和发布版。历史追溯功能则帮助团队快速定位问题回溯某一阶段的文档状态避免因误操作导致的信息丢失。**权限管理与协作机制**在多角色协作的项目中文档的访问与编辑权限需严格管理。例如开发人员可能只需查看技术文档而产品经理需要编辑需求文档。通过权限分级如只读、编辑、管理员可以防止未授权修改或信息泄露。协作工具如Confluence、Notion支持多人实时编辑和评论提升团队沟通效率同时保留修改记录便于追踪责任。**自动化与持续集成**为减少人工维护成本文档生成与更新应尽可能自动化。例如通过代码注释自动生成API文档如Swagger或利用CI/CD工具在代码合并时同步更新相关文档。自动化不仅提高效率还能减少人为错误。定期扫描文档中的死链、过期内容并自动提醒维护确保文档的时效性。**定期审核与优化**文档管理并非一劳永逸需定期审核与优化。团队可设立文档评审机制例如每月检查一次技术文档的准确性或每季度更新用户手册。通过反馈收集如用户调查、团队讨论发现文档的不足并持续改进。优化后的文档应归档备份便于后续项目复用形成知识沉淀。软件文档的管理化并非单纯的技术问题而是团队协作与流程规范的结合。通过分类标准化、版本控制、权限管理、自动化和定期审核团队能够构建高效、可靠的文档体系为项目成功奠定坚实基础。

更多文章